titleOfInvention Activation of ground granulated blast furnace slag
abstract An improved mineral binder composition including: a mineral binder including at least 30 weight-% slag, based on the weight of the mineral binder, an activator for the hydration of the slag consisting of or comprising calcium hydroxide and a co-activator consisting of or including at least one salt selected from the group consisting of lithium carbonate, lithium sulfate and sodium carbonate.
